Brown Advisory Inc. increased its stake in shares of Vanguard S&P Mid-Cap 400 ETF (NYSEARCA:IVOO – Free Report) by 1,249.2% during the 2nd qu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The firm owned 59,944 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 55,501 shares during the quarter. Brown Advisory Inc.’s holdings in Vanguard S&P Mid-Cap 400 ETF were worth $6,293,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Vanguard S&P Mid-Cap 400 ETF Profile
The Vanguard S&P Mid-Cap 400 ETF (IVOO)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the S&P Mid Cap 400 index. The fund tracks a market cap-weighted index of mid-cap US companies. IVOO was launched on Sep 9, 2010 and is managed by Vanguard.
